What if you've got an error for the form, in general, and that doesn't pertain to any field in particular. For instance, the new data being input conflict with data from a different table? Does it have to be form.errors.<fieldname>?
On Dec 6, 6:50 pm, mdipierro <mdipie...@cs.depaul.edu> wrote: > This should never have worked and I am surprised you did not get an > error before. form.errors has to be a storage object. Here is what it > should be: > > if form.vars.stop < form.vars.start: > form.errors.stop=T('Error: Stop is before start') > return False > return True > > On Dec 6, 4:56 pm, weheh <richard_gor...@verizon.net> wrote: > > > > > Some code that worked fine on 1.64.3 isn't working on 1.72.3, to which > > I just upgraded. I upgraded from source, so I wouldn't be surprised if > > I'm missing a file or something like that. The error message is: > > > File "C:\web2py\gluon\sqlhtml.py", line 769, in accepts > > for key in self.errors.keys(): > > AttributeError: 'lazyT' object has no attribute 'keys' > > > and is being generated by the following code which is being called as > > part of a form validator routine: > > > @auth.requires_login() > > def valid_datetimes(form): > > #------------------------------------------------------------------------------- > > """Sets form.errors if stop before start""" > > if form.vars.stop < form.vars.start: > > form.errors=T('Error: Stop is before start') > > return False > > return True > > > The test condition was that form.vars.stop < form.vars.start, > > triggering the form.errors getting assigned. > > > Anyone have any insight into what might be happening here?
